Elche preview: Entertaining Elche

It was an impressive first-half to this season, with Eder Sarabia at the helm, but Elche have since collapsed this time around, albeit they are showing signs of being able to pull away from the drop zone once again.

That is because of a victory over Real Mallorca a few weeks ago, but they then succumbed to a slender 1-0 loss away to Rayo Vallecano at Vallecas in Madrid last weekend, going down to ten men before half-time.

Valencia preview: Pushing away

They now face a Valencia side that have pushed themselves clear of the bottom three and the relegation places with former West Bromwich Albion manager Carlos Corberan able to ease some of the pressure on his position.

Los Che come into this one on the back of a 3-2 defeat to Celta Vigo at Mestalla last weekend, with Valencia having taken an early lead before being outplayed by the Galicians and then scoring a late consolation.
